Position Overview:

The Senior Director of Finance Platforms will lead the strategy, governance, and delivery of enterprise finance technology platforms, ensuring they enable efficient, scalable, and compliant financial operations. This role requires deep expertise in finance systems such as Kyriba (Treasury Management), Ariba (Procurement), Esker (AP Automation), and experience driving Finance Transformation initiatives across global organizations. The ideal candidate will combine strong technical platform knowledge with leadership skills to align technology solutions with business objectives.

Key Responsibilities:

Platform Ownership & Strategy

  • Define and execute the roadmap for finance platforms including Kyriba, Ariba, Esker, and related systems.

  • Ensure platforms support global finance and accounting processes, compliance, and scalability.

  • Evaluate emerging technologies and recommend enhancements to optimize financial operations.

Finance Transformation Leadership

  • Drive end-to-end transformation initiatives to modernize finance processes and systems.

  • Partner with Finance leadership to identify opportunities for automation, efficiency, and cost optimization.

  • Lead change management efforts to ensure successful adoption of new tools and processes.

Governance & Risk Management

  • Establish governance frameworks for platform usage, data integrity, and security compliance.

  • Ensure adherence to regulatory requirements and internal controls across all finance systems.

Stakeholder Collaboration

  • Act as the primary liaison between Finance, IT, Procurement, and external vendors.

  • Align platform capabilities with business needs through continuous engagement with stakeholders.

  • Communicate platform strategy and progress to executive leadership.

Team Leadership & Development

  • Build and lead a high-performing team of product owners, analysts, and technical specialists.

  • Foster a culture of innovation, collaboration, and continuous improvement.

Continuous Improvement & Performance Monitoring

  • Define KPIs and success metrics for platform performance and transformation initiatives.

  • Monitor system performance and user experience, implementing enhancements as needed.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Information Systems, or related field; MBA or advanced degree preferred.

  • 10 or more years of experience in finance technology leadership roles, with proven platform ownership experience.

  • 5 or more years as a Subject Matter Expert in Kyriba, Ariba, Esker, and other finance systems (SAP, DataBricks and visualization tools) - required

  • Demonstrated success in leading finance transformation initiatives in a global organization.

  • Strong understanding of financial processes including treasury, procurement, AP automation, and accounting.

  • Excellent leadership, communication, and stakeholder management skills.

Preferred Skills:

  • Experience with cloud-based finance platforms and integration strategies.

  • Experience with Agile methodologies and digital transformation best practices.

  • Ability to manage vendor relationships and negotiate contracts effectively.

  • Experience with AI, M/L and EPM data models

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ills

  • Ability to work well both independently as well as within a team oriented environment
